J&W AutoGlass, located in Benson, North Carolina, offers top-notch Door Installation and Repair Services in the 27504 area. For quality Door Installation and Repair Services you can trust, give them a call at 919.894.5418.
Services
Please check out this space for services offered.
Video
If you are the owner of this page login to add your video now! (Youtube/Vimeo/Daily Motion)